
Not long after the Asus announced ZenFone 2 as the first smartphone in the world that offers a RAM 4 GB of RAM, Xiaomi Mi participate introduce Note Pro with 4 GB of RAM. Well now turn Lenovo launches a smartphone with 4 GB of RAM.
Called Lenovo K80, the new smartphone will be dealing directly with the Asus ZenFone 2 not only because both offer 4 GB of RAM, but also because of the price and other features are relatively similar to Zenfone 2.
Lenovo K80 running Android Lollipop, bearing the 5.5-inch 1080p screen, and is supported by 64-bit 1.8 GHz Intel Atom processor. The phone also offers LTE, rear 13 MP rear camera with Optical Image Stabilization, 64 GB of storage space, and a large battery capacity of 4000 mAh. K80 has a thickness of 8.5mm, and come in a wide range of colors, including black, silver, and red.
Starting 30 April Lenovo K80 will be available in China, priced at 1,799 yuan, or about Rp 3.5 million. As for the model with 2 GB RAM and 32 GB of storage space will also be released diharga 1,499 yuan, or about 2.9 million.
